首页
学习
活动
专区
圈层
工具
发布

TDSQL-C PostgreSQL(CynosDB) 内核实现剖析一

| 导语 TDSQL-C PostgreSQL(CynosDB)是腾讯云数据库团队自研的新一代云原生数据库,融合了传统数据库、云计算与新硬件技术的优势,采用计算和存储分离的架构,100%兼容 PostgreSQL...本文旨在从数据库内核的角度揭秘TDSQL-C PostgreSQL计算层的技术内幕。本文适合读者:腾讯云售后服务,TDSQL-C用户,TDSQL-C开发者,需要有基本的数据库与存储知识。...《TDSQL-C PostgreSQL(CynosDB) 内核解密》文章已总体介绍了TDSQL-C核心架构与关键技术,本文下面将介绍TDSQL-C 计算层内核相关实现细节。...TDSQL-C 架构最终脱离了PostgreSQL原生的XLOG,同时对XLOG相关的一些特性也做了调整和优化。...,设计和实现高性能新一代云数据库,TDSQL-C PG还有很长的路要走,如果你也对数据库领域技术感兴趣,欢迎加入我们,让我们一起见证TDSQL-C PG 攀登世界的顶峰。

1.2K30

TDSQL-C PostgreSQL(CynosDB) 内核实现剖析二

| 导语 TDSQL-C PostgreSQL(CynosDB)是腾讯云数据库团队自研的新一代云原生数据库,融合了传统数据库、云计算与新硬件技术的优势,采用计算和存储分离的架构,100%兼容 PostgreSQL...本文旨在从数据库内核的角度揭秘TDSQL-C PostgreSQL存储层的技术内幕。本文适合读者:腾讯云售后服务,TDSQL-C用户,TDSQL-C开发者,需要有基本的数据库与存储知识。...《TDSQL-C PostgreSQL(CynosDB) 内核解密》文章已总体介绍了TDSQL-C核心架构与关键技术,本文下面将介绍TDSQL-C 存储层内核实现细节。...元数据管理详细内容见《TDSQL-C PostgreSQL(CynosDB) 元数据管理》文章介绍分析。...备份回档详细内容见《TDSQL-C PostgreSQL(CynosDB) 备份回档》文章介绍分析。

1.2K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    云原生数据库TDSQL-C PostgreSQL版内核解密

    本文旨在从数据库内核的角度揭秘TDSQL-C PostgreSQL的核心架构与关键技术。本文适合读者:腾讯云售后服务、TDSQL-C用户、TDSQL-C开发者,需要有基本的数据库与存储知识。...TDSQL-C 技术优势 TDSQL-C PostgreSQL技术优势 1.日志即数据库 TDSQL-C 引入计算存储分离的设计,存储层使用共享的分布式存储,计算层则将传统数据库不必要的IO全部卸载,如上图所示写...4.完全兼容 TDSQL-C完全兼容PostgreSQL,代码/应用无需修改或只需少量修改,业务无需改造即可平滑迁移。同时TDSQL-C 会定期实现对PostgreSQL新版本的兼容性。...可以使用PostgreSQL 导入/导出工具或者快照,将PostgreSQL 数据库轻松迁移到TDSQL-C。...TDSQL-C 总结 TDSQL-C PG版性能上均优于其他竞品,性能数倍于社区原生PostgreSQL。

    2.4K51

    TDSQL-C PostgreSQL(CynosDB) 内核解密-披荆斩棘,勇往直前的腾讯云数据库

    | 导语 TDSQL-C PostgreSQL(CynosDB)是腾讯云数据库团队自研的新一代云原生数据库,融合了传统数据库、云计算与新硬件技术的优势,采用计算和存储分离的架构,100%兼容 PostgreSQL...本文旨在从数据库内核的角度揭秘TDSQL-C PostgreSQL的核心架构与关键技术。本文适合读者:腾讯云售后服务,TDSQL-C用户,TDSQL-C开发者,需要有基本的数据库与存储知识。...同时TDSQL-C 会定期实现对PostgreSQL新版本的兼容性。可以使用PostgreSQL 导入/导出工具或者快照,将PostgreSQL 数据库轻松迁移到TDSQL-C。...四、总结 TDSQL-C性能上均优于其他竞品,性能数倍于社区原生PostgreSQL。...更多细节请参考: 计算层《TDSQL-C PostgreSQL(CynosDB) 内核实现剖析一》 存储层《TDSQL-C PostgreSQL(CynosDB) 内核实现剖析二》 五、相关概念 Segment

    1.1K30

    腾讯云原生数据库TDSQL-C斩获2021PostgreSQL中国最佳数据库产品奖

    在2021年度PostgreSQL中国技术评选发布仪式上,经由组委会专家严格评审,腾讯云数据库被评为“2021PostgreSQL中国最佳服务商”,同时腾讯云原生数据库TDSQL-C凭借其先进架构、OLTP...TDSQL-C 100%兼容MySQL和 PostgreSQL,无需改动代码,即可完成现有数据库的查询、应用和工具平滑迁移;拥有商用数据库的强劲性能,最高性能是 MySQL 数据库8倍、PostgreSQL...此外,TDSQL-C PostgreSQL版采用计算和存储分离的架构,所有计算节点共享一份数据,存储容量高达128TB,单库最高可扩展至16节点,提供秒级的配置升降级、秒级的故障恢复和数据备份容灾服务。...TDSQL-C PG版既融合了商业数据库稳定可靠、高性能、可扩展的特征,又具有开源云数据库简单开放、自我迭代的优势。...对于TDSQL-C PostgreSQL版,腾讯公司具有完全自主知识产权,实现安全可控, 具备在中高端市场规模化替代国外数据库的能力,能够在数据库基础软件层面有力支撑国家安全可控战略发展。

    1.2K70

    腾讯云TDSQL-C架构解析

    云原生数据库 TDSQL-C(Cloud Native Database TDSQL-C)简称 TDSQL-C,当年的名称是:CynosDB,后面为了统一名称,我们全部使用TDSQL-C。...融合了传统数据库、云计算与新硬件技术的优势,100%兼容 MySQL 和 PostgreSQL,实现超百万级QPS的高吞吐,128TB海量分布式智能存储,保障数据安全可靠。...因为TDSQL-C对外的资料比较少,我们这里就直接引用官方对客户分析一个图片,看看TDSQL-C的架构: ? 从架构上来看TDSQL-C分成了两层:计算层和存储层。...计算层支持:MySQL, PostgreSQL,目前从资料中推断应该是使用了开源的版本,所以可以保持和对应的MySQL和PostgreSQL保持100%的兼容,同样在计算层无持久化的存储。...因TDSQL-C手里资料不多,不能进一步的解析,欢迎了解或是使用过TDSQL-C的朋友提供使用经验分享。

    3.9K30

    在线畅游腾讯云PostgreSQL家族,明天见!

    议题二:TDSQL-C PostgreSQL版的高可用特性(1月8日上午9:30-10:00) 分享嘉宾:唐颋,腾讯云数据库高级工程师 腾讯云高级工程师,具有多年公有云数据库的管理和研发经验。...目前负责 TDSQL-C PostgreSQL管控层相关的功能研发。...议题详情:云原生数据库 TDSQL-C(Cloud Native Database TDSQL-C,TDSQL-C)是腾讯云自研的新一代高性能高可用的企业级分布式云数据库。...本次分享将会针对TDSQL-C PostreSQL在高可用方面的特性进行详细的介绍。...议题六:TDSQL-C for PostgreSQL 主从架构详解(1月8日上午11:30-12:00) 分享嘉宾:邹立贤,腾讯云数据库专家工程师 腾讯云专家工程师,长期从事数据库内核开发,曾就职于人大金仓

    1.7K40

    顶级云原生数据库长啥样?鹅厂专家天团已就位

    分 论 坛  云原生数据库TDSQL-C MySQL内核演进实践 李昕龙 14:00--14:40 腾讯云专家工程师,拥有多年分布式数据库内核研发经验,目前在TDSQL-C团队负责数据库内核优化以及关键特性设计开发...本次分享将介绍TDSQL-C面对真实复杂的用户场景,对数据库内核技术的探索和演进实践。...云原生数据库 TDSQL-C PostgreSQL 的发展思路 窦贤明 15:20--16:00 腾讯云数据库专家工程师,从事云数据库产品研发多年,从零到一主导研发多款云数据库、云原生数据库。...目前负责 TDSQL-C PostgreSQL、TencentDB For PostgreSQL 的全栈研发工作,和TDSQL-C MySQL 的产品化研发工作。 ‍...TDSQL-C PostgreSQL 是一款由腾讯云全栈自研的新一代云原生关系型数据库。

    92720

    腾讯云数据库公有云市场稳居TOP 2!

    腾讯公有云关系型数据库涵盖云原生数据库TDSQL-C、云数据库MySQL、云数据库PostgreSQL、云数据库MariaDB等产品矩阵,具有动态弹性、快速配置等优势。...以腾讯云原生数据库TDSQL-C(原 CynosDB)为例,这是腾讯自主研发的新一代高性能、高可用数据库,100%兼容MySQL和PostgreSQL。...6月16日,TDSQL-C新版本正式对外,在云原生架构、基础硬件能力、自研内核等方面进行了全面升级。...(←点击蓝字查看详情) 观看视频,了解更多TDSQL-C产品信息 云原生数据库TDSQL-C也是国内首个Serverless架构的云数据库,通过自感知负载弹性伸缩的自动驾驶能力,可实现秒级从几十QPS...﹀ ﹀ ﹀ -- 更多精彩 -- 腾讯云原生数据库TDSQL-C入选信通院《云原生产品目录》 腾讯云TDSQL-C重磅升级,性能全面领跑云原生数据库市场 ↓↓点击阅读原文,了解更多优惠

    2.5K20

    TDSQL-C for MySQL与阿里云PolarDB深度选型指南

    本文将深入探讨腾讯云的TDSQL-C for MySQL版和阿里云的PolarDB,帮助企业根据自身需求做出最佳选择。...TDSQL-C for MySQL简介 TDSQL-C for MySQL是腾讯云推出的一款高性能、高可用、可扩展的云原生数据库产品,兼容MySQL协议,适用于需要高性能和高并发处理能力的业务场景。...阿里云PolarDB简介 阿里云PolarDB是一种兼容MySQL、PostgreSQL和Oracle的高性能关系型数据库服务,它采用存储计算分离架构,具有高性能、高可用性和弹性伸缩的特点。...兼容性对比 TDSQL-C for MySQL:完全兼容MySQL协议,便于迁移和开发。 PolarDB:支持MySQL、PostgreSQL和Oracle等多种数据库协议,兼容性更强。...结论 选择TDSQL-C for MySQL还是阿里云PolarDB,需要根据业务场景的具体需求来决定。如果你的业务需要极致的性能和低延迟,TDSQL-C for MySQL可能是更好的选择。

    26810

    云原生数据库免费体验:腾讯云TDSQL-C引领企业上云新浪潮

    腾讯云TDSQL-C作为自研新一代企业级分布式云数据库,具备以下核心优势: 100%兼容MySQL和PostgreSQL,迁移成本趋近于零 超百万级QPS高吞吐,满足高并发场景需求 最高400TB海量存储...适用人群 云原生数据库TDSQL-C 免费试用15天 2核4G20G 个人/企业认证用户 云原生数据库TDSQL-C 免费试用30天 1核1G20G 个人/企业认证用户 三、特惠活动选购指南 根据腾讯云最新活动政策...,TDSQL-C特惠活动为长期活动,具体如下: TDSQL-C MySQL 版体验:新老用户同享,2核4G TDSQL-C MySQL +10GB存储空间,3个月体验价49.9元(0.5折); TDSQL-C...MySQL 版特卖:新老用户同享,TDSQL-C MySQL优惠后价格4.5折起; ###四、 技术特性对比分析 功能特性 传统云数据库 TDSQL-C云原生数据库 兼容性 基础兼容 100%兼容MySQL.../PostgreSQL 扩展性 分钟级扩容 秒级弹性扩缩容 存储上限 TB级别 400TB海量存储 故障恢复 分钟级切换 秒级故障恢复 架构优势 传统主从 计算存储分离 结语 云计算的时代浪潮下,技术的门槛与成本正被不断刷新

    14910

    数据库免费体验指南:腾讯云TDSQL-C引领云原生时代

    腾讯云TDSQL-C作为企业级分布式云数据库,融合了传统数据库、云计算与新硬件技术的优势,在保证100%兼容MySQL和PostgreSQL的同时,实现了超百万级QPS的高吞吐能力。...二、腾讯云TDSQL-C核心优势解析 全面兼容性:TDSQL-C完全兼容MySQL 5.7、8.0和PostgreSQL 10.17,用户几乎无需改动代码即可完成迁移。...企业认证用户 云原生数据库TDSQL-C 免费试用30天 1核1G20G 个人/企业认证用户 试用期间,用户可充分体验TDSQL-C的自动扩缩容、秒级备份恢复等核心功能,为后续正式使用奠定基础。...四、特惠活动选购指南 根据腾讯云最新活动政策,TDSQL-C特惠活动为长期活动,具体如下: TDSQL-C MySQL 版体验:新老用户同享,2核4G TDSQL-C MySQL +10GB存储空间...,3个月体验价49.9元(0.5折); TDSQL-C MySQL 版特卖:新老用户同享,TDSQL-C MySQL优惠后价格4.5折起; 五、实战应用场景分析 对于互联网游戏行业,TDSQL-C的秒级快照备份和快速回档能力可有效保障数据安全

    23010

    腾讯云原生数据库TDSQL-C入选信通院《云原生产品目录》

    近日,中国信通院、云计算开源产业联盟正式对外发布《云原生产品目录》,腾讯云原生数据库TDSQL-C凭借其超强性能、极致效率的弹性伸缩和完善的产品化解决方案体系,成功入围目录。...本次入围目录也表明TDSQL-C的产品和技术能力获得了业界肯定。 2022年6月,TDSQL-C 发布的新版本在云原生架构、基础硬件能力、自研内核等方面进行了全面升级。...性能测试结果(点击跳转详情)显示,在全缓存场景、大数据集场景中,新版TDSQL-C 性能全面超越业内其他云原生数据库产品,对比传统云数据库达到200%性能提升。...TDSQL-C 100% 兼容 MySQL 和 PostgreSQL, 无需改动代码 , 即可完成现有数据库的查询、应用和工具平滑迁移 ; 拥有商用数据库的强劲性能 , 最高性能是 MySQL 社区版的...8 倍、PostgreSQL 社区版的 4 倍 ; 计算节点实现无状态 , 支持秒级平滑故障恢复和秒级弹性伸缩;自动维护数据、备份的多个副本和多可用区部署 , 保障数据安全可靠 , 可靠性达 99.9999999%

    1.1K20

    【腾讯云 TDSQL-C Serverless 产品体验】TDSQL-C MySQL Serverless最佳实践

    TDSQL-C MySQL Serverless数据库实例的优势:与普通MySQL数据库实例相比,TDSQL-C MySQL Serverless数据库实例有如下6点明显的优势:优势:①....3.2 传统TDSQL-C Serverless架构中的自动扩缩容方案:而上图右侧TDSQL-C Serverless架构中,用户在购买时选择最小规格为1核2G,最大规格为4核8G。...TDSQL-C Serverless会在初始就给用户提供最大CPU规格,内存则从最小规格开始。可以看出,TDSQL-C Serverless的CPU资源不会受限,可以在设置的最大规格内任意使用。...基于以下两点,TDSQL-C Serverless可以很好应对自动扩缩容:TDSQL-C Serverless自动扩缩容方案:①....五、TDSQL-C MySQL Serverless弹性伸缩实验:下面将按照以下5个大的步骤进行对TDSQL-C MySQL Serverless的一个压力的测试过程。

    14.1K861

    腾讯云TDSQL-C五项全能,性能、弹性双冠!

    本文基于2025年9月腾讯云官网最新信息,聚焦云原生数据库TDSQL-C,从兼容性、性能、价格、弹性、安全五大维度横向对比,帮助中小企业与开发者在十分钟内锁定最优解。...TDSQL-C 100%兼容MySQL 5.7/8.0与PostgreSQL 10.17,常用框架、BI工具、可视化客户端可直接连接,官方实测无需改动一行SQL即可完成平滑迁移。...六、横向对比:TDSQL-C vs 传统云数据库 vs 自建MySQL 维度 TDSQL-C 传统云MySQL 自建MySQL 兼容性 原生协议,无需改代码 原生协议 原生协议 性能 百万QPS,内核级优化...登录腾讯云→产品→数据库→TDSQL-C→“立即选购”; 选版本(MySQL/PostgreSQL)、选可用区、勾“Serverless”即享弹性; 下单后3分钟完成初始化,控制台一键获取连接串...上云不将就,数据库就选TDSQL-C,立即前往腾讯云官网体验!

    64210

    TDSQL-C OOM 优化

    本文将基于TDSQL-C(基于MySQL5.7)总结一下在线上经常出现的一些OOM的场景、排查手段及相应的优化方案。...前面讲了TDSQL-C相对传统数据库的优势,接下来介绍TDSQL-C在内存使用方面相对传统MySQL在内存使用方面存在哪些弊端。...---- 三、TDSQL-C OOM 优化 3.1 TDSQL-C Server端参数优化 我们在不影响数据库性能的前提下修改实例默认配置来降低内存占用(括号内为优化后的默认值),主要包括以下参数的调整...TDSQL-C内核团队在TDSQL-C的内存管理上进行一系列的优化,包括优化server端参数配置降低内存占用、丰富内存监控、增加buffer pool冷热page数查询方便用户设置更合理的buffer...后续我们也会持续进行优化,不断提升TDSQL-C的稳定性和可用性,为用户带来更好的产品体验。

    2K42

    厉害了!TDSQL再获2021年度技术卓越奖

    IT168对外公布的“数据库·数据风云奖”评选中,经由行业技术专家及IT媒体多方联合评审,腾讯云企业级分布式数据库TDSQL凭借其出众的产品实力斩获‘‘2021年度技术卓越奖’’,这是继本月获得‘‘2021PostgreSQL...中国最佳服务商’’‘‘2021PostgreSQL中国最佳数据库产品’’之后再次获奖。...TDSQL-C 则推出了业内领先的serverless形态能力,支持按实际计算和存储资源使用量收取费用,整个服务监控力度达到秒级级别。...TDSQL-C 可以自动判断计算层面资源可以实现计算关停和热启动,启动时间在3s以内,目前已经服务了50万小程序开发者,将云原生技术普惠用户。...腾讯云原生数据库TDSQL-C斩获2021PostgreSQL中国最佳数据库产品奖 权威认可!

    1.9K60

    再获认可!腾讯云TDSQL斩获可信云技术最佳实践奖

    7月28日,由中国信息通信研究院、中国通信标准化协会联合主办的“2021可信云大会”上,腾讯云原生数据库TDSQL-C 凭借100%兼容 MySQL 和 PostgreSQL、实现超百万级QPS的高吞吐...和PostgreSQL 等开源数据库,实现了超百万级 QPS 的吞吐,超百 TB 的海量分布式智能存储,几乎无需改动代码,即可完成现有业务、应用和工具平滑迁移。...TDSQL-C 通过支持计算节点的快速弹性扩展和故障恢复。可以秒级完成纵向扩展 (Scale Up)和横向扩展(Scale Out)。...国内领先的第三方电子合同平台法大大的核心业务就运行在TDSQL-C上。...TDSQL-C的云分布式存储服务的弹性及海量存储的能力很好地解决了传统MySQL存储容量的问题,而基于快照的备份方式也很好地实现了大数据量的备份及按时间点恢复TDSQL-C采用读写分离架构,支持应用服务器并发访问

    70340
    领券